Knee replacement surgery, or knee arthroplasty, is a transformative surgical procedure designed to alleviate pain, correct misalignment, and restore functionality to damaged knee joints. This advanced technique involves replacing the damaged surfaces of the knee joint with artificial components, offering patients a new lease on life.
Benefits of Knee Replacement Surgery
1. Pain Relief: One of the most significant benefits of knee replacement surgery is the relief from chronic pain caused by osteoarthritis and other knee conditions.
2. Improved Mobility: Patients often experience a significant improvement in their ability to walk, climb stairs, and perform other daily activities without discomfort.
3. Corrected Alignment: The surgery corrects misalignment issues, leading to better posture and overall balance.
4. Enhanced Quality of Life: Patients can return to a more active and fulfilling lifestyle with reduced pain and improved mobility.
The Surgical Procedure
In both partial and total knee replacement surgeries, the process involves several key steps:
1. Preoperative Assessment: A thorough evaluation of the patient’s medical history, physical condition, and imaging studies to plan the surgery.
2. Anesthesia: Administering spinal or general anesthesia to ensure the patient is comfortable and pain-free during the procedure.
3. Incision and Exposure: Making an incision to access the knee joint and exposing the damaged areas.
4. Resurfacing: Removing the damaged bone and cartilage from the affected compartments of the knee.
5. Implant Placement: Inserting the artificial components made of metal and plastic to replace the damaged surfaces.
6. Closure: Closing the incision with sutures or staples and applying a sterile dressing.
Recovery and Rehabilitation
Recovery from knee replacement surgery involves a combination of rest, physical therapy, and gradual resumption of activities. Here are some key aspects of the recovery process:
• Early Mobilization: Patients are encouraged to start moving the knee joint soon after surgery with the help of a physical therapist.
• Physical Therapy: A structured physical therapy program helps in regaining strength, flexibility, and range of motion.
• Pain Management: Effective pain management strategies, including medications and cold therapy, ensure patient comfort.
• Follow-Up Care: Regular follow-up visits with the surgeon to monitor progress and address any concerns.
